Consequences of kissing a deceased person: what you should know

Why Kissing the Deceased Can Be Risky. Losing someone we love is heartbreaking, and in moments of grief, a final kiss may feel like a gesture of love. But from a health standpoint, it can be risky.

After death, the body begins decomposing quickly. Here are some health risks of kissing a deceased person:

  1. Bacterial Infections – Natural bacteria multiply after death and can cause serious infections.

  2. Active Viruses – Some viruses (like hepatitis or tuberculosis) may remain active briefly after death.

  3. Decomposition Fluids – These fluids contain harmful microorganisms that can cause illness.

  4. Toxic Gases – Decomposition releases gases that may irritate the lungs or cause dizziness.

  5. Emotional Impact – Seeing and touching the body closely can deepen grief or trigger trauma.

  6. Cross-Contamination – Kissing the body may spread germs at funerals.

  7. Chemical Reactions – Embalming chemicals can cause skin or respiratory irritation.

A Safer Goodbye

There are other meaningful ways to say farewell—holding their hand, a gentle touch, or simply being present. Protecting your health is also a way to honor the person you’ve lost.
